Dan Levings has diverse experience in web development and software engineering. Dan began their career as a freelance web developer, focusing on web design and development training. Dan then worked as a contract web developer at Highbury College, where they designed and developed various projects, including a landing page for their VLE system. Levings also gained experience as a front-end developer at Ultimate Insurance Solutions, where they worked on front-end languages and back-end skills, as well as taking on leadership and training responsibilities. Dan further expanded their web development skills at WorldSkills International as a UK Squad Trainer. Levings also worked as a web developer at Who Dares, Pasla Online, and Mazz-Tec, where they handled tasks such as migrating systems to modern content management systems, assisting with website-related issues, and providing support across web development areas. Most recently, Levings served as a principal software engineer at Cognite AS, utilizing their expertise in software engineering.

Dan Levings has a strong educational background in the field of Computer Engineering and Software Engineering. In 2007, they completed their GCSE at Brune Park. From 2012 to 2014, they pursued a BTEC Extended Diploma in Software Development with a focus on Mathematics and Computer Science at Highbury College. Following that, from 2014 to 2017, they attended City of Portsmouth College to obtain a Foundation degree in Software Engineering. Lastly, from 2016 onwards, they enrolled at Arden University and is currently pursuing a Bachelor's Degree in Computer Engineering. Additionally, they have obtained a Performance Excellence Qualification from NCFE, although specific details about this certification are not provided.
